lad_newton (4207) reviewed Riwaka from Pictish Brewing 11 months 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 7 | Overall - 7
Cask at the Kelham Island Tavern, Sheffield on 20th February 2025. Pale gold with dense, off-white foam depositing full lacing. Citrus aroma with caramel malt. Juicy fruits in-mouth and a sweet, fruity candy finish. Medium bodied with a smooth mouthfeel.
stevoj (18327) reviewed Alchemists Ale from Pictish Brewing 11 months 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 7.5 | Flavor - 8 | Texture - 9 | Overall - 7.5
Half cask at Kelham Island Tavern. Golden pour with a creamy white head, rings of lacing. Light biscuity, grainy aroma. Taste is soft and smooth, white bread, grainy, mild sweetness. Creamy, velvety feel.

dragnet101 (5184) reviewed Wakatu from Pictish Brewing 1 year 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 7
Cask from The Wellington, Birmingham. Dark clear gold with nice off white top, good lacing. Quite bitter and leafy but there is enough sweetness and fruitiness (lemon and berry notes) to ensure its not astringent. Medium bodied, goes down well. Decent.
